Key Responsibilities as a Personal Care Aide:
- Personal Care: Assist residents with daily living activities such as bathing, grooming, dressing, and eating, ensuring their comfort and dignity.
- Health Monitoring: Observe and report changes in residents' health status to the nursing team, documenting care provided and resident responses.
- Supportive Care: Provide emotional and social support to residents, fostering a positive and caring environment.
- Collaboration: Work collaboratively with nursing staff and other healthcare professionals to coordinate care and enhance resident well-being.
- Education: Assist in educating residents and families about health management and available resources.
